Take advantage of Emerline’s expertise in Ruby and Ruby on Rails end-to-end development services and receive complex web solutions in the shortest time possible.

Ruby Web Development Services on Offer

Ruby language and Ruby on Rails framework go hand in hand, with the latter depending on the first. While Ruby is used as an alternative to Python, as it allows the creation of data analysis applications, its popular framework, Ruby on Rails, is known to be one of the most demanded technologies for the rapid development of scalable web applications.

Whether you want to hire Ruby developers for the creation from scratch, enhancement, customization, or support of your Ruby application, Emerline has got you covered. Ruby and Ruby on Rails development services we offer include:

Consulting

Take advantage of our experienced business analysts and Ruby developers to create a straightforward development strategy aimed at achieving your business goals with Ruby and RoR solutions.

Web development

Being one of those companies that use Ruby on Rails since the inception, we ensure fast delivery, perfect code, precise technical quality, and pleasing visual appeal of web apps.

MVP development

Knowing exactly how to make the most out of Ruby and RoR benefits, we create MVPs in the shortest time possible, as well as ensure their flexibility for future adjustments and modifications

API development

Our Ruby developers offer their expertise in the creation of API-only applications, customization of APIs in accordance with our clients’ business needs, and the development of REST APIs that ensure the solution’s flexibility.

Maintenance & support

Whether there is a need for software updates, speed optimization, backups, UI or security improvements, etc. — Emerline RoR and Ruby developers will ensure that your application works as planned and provides desirable results.

Code audit & refactoring

As a Ruby on Rails development company, Emerline knows how to audit the codebase of your applications, whether based on Ruby or RoR. In this way, we ensure the improvements of your app’s functioning, making it smooth and fault-free.

Still have some doubts on whether Ruby suits your project needs or want to learn more about it?

If you are looking for a Ruby development company to meet your tech expectations, know how we can help.

Ruby Frameworks and Libraries We Use

Ruby application development at Emerline includes the use of various frameworks and libraries that open up space for more flexibility and creativity in projects we work on. Among the technologies and tools we use are Ruby on Rails, Sinatra, Rack, Puma, Redis, Resque, Sidekiq, REST-Client, JBuilder, OAuth2, Doorkeeper, Pundit, AWS-SDK, etc.

1.

Ruby on Rails

The most widely used, very flexible, and lightweight framework that allows addressing a lot of development issues, especially when it comes to the creation of web solutions.

2.

Sinatra

Our Ruby developers utilize this library when there is a need to deliver simple and dynamic web applications in the shortest time.

3.

Rack

Giving a common language and a consistent interface to web server developers and application framework developers, Rack is used by our experts as an underlying technology with fluid API.

4.

Puma

When dealing with data, our experts utilize the Redis data structure store that allows a variety of automatic operations and has an in-memory data set that ensures top performance.

5.

Redis

When dealing with data, our experts utilize the Redis data structure store that allows a variety of automatic operations and has an in-memory data set that ensures top performance.

6.

AWS SDK

When working with Amazon Web Services (AWS) in Ruby projects, our experts apply their expertise in AWS SDK to ease the coding and get faster and greater results.

1.

Ruby on Rails

The most widely used, very flexible, and lightweight framework that allows addressing a lot of development issues, especially when it comes to the creation of web solutions.

2.

Sinatra

Our Ruby developers utilize this library when there is a need to deliver simple and dynamic web applications in the shortest time.

3.

Rack

Giving a common language and a consistent interface to web server developers and application framework developers, Rack is used by our experts as an underlying technology with fluid API.

4.

Puma

When dealing with data, our experts utilize the Redis data structure store that allows a variety of automatic operations and has an in-memory data set that ensures top performance.

5.

Redis

When dealing with data, our experts utilize the Redis data structure store that allows a variety of automatic operations and has an in-memory data set that ensures top performance.

6.

AWS SDK

When working with Amazon Web Services (AWS) in Ruby projects, our experts apply their expertise in AWS SDK to ease the coding and get faster and greater results.

1.

Ruby on Rails

The most widely used, very flexible, and lightweight framework that allows addressing a lot of development issues, especially when it comes to the creation of web solutions.

2.

Sinatra

Our Ruby developers utilize this library when there is a need to deliver simple and dynamic web applications in the shortest time.

3.

Rack

Giving a common language and a consistent interface to web server developers and application framework developers, Rack is used by our experts as an underlying technology with fluid API.

4.

Puma

When dealing with data, our experts utilize the Redis data structure store that allows a variety of automatic operations and has an in-memory data set that ensures top performance.

5.

Redis

When dealing with data, our experts utilize the Redis data structure store that allows a variety of automatic operations and has an in-memory data set that ensures top performance.

6.

AWS SDK

When working with Amazon Web Services (AWS) in Ruby projects, our experts apply their expertise in AWS SDK to ease the coding and get faster and greater results.

Awards

Throughout our history, we have developed a number of partnerships with technology leaders, who attested our technical competencies and the ability to understand our customers’ needs and translate them into quality services
view all awards

Why Choose Emerline for Ruby and RoR Development?

With tens of successfully completed RoR and Ruby projects, our teams know exactly how to make the most out of these technologies.

We take advantage of Ruby for the creation of:

  • Fast and simple web app development;

  • Enhancement of web solutions;

  • Development of data analysis applications;

  • Prototyping;

  • POC development, etc.

    When creating web solutions, our Ruby developers appreciate using the RoR framework, and for good reasons:

  • It speeds up the development with a variety of tools and common patterns;

  • RoR libraries allow building complex functionality with ease;

  • Testing with RoR is fast and fault-free thanks to the built-in automated testing;

  • It opens up space for the creation of elegant and powerful code that is easy to understand;

  • RoR provides much flexibility, allowing to change approaches to architecture and scale.

    Whether it is Ruby development or the RoR project, you can always rely on our expertise. With Emerline as your technology partner, things will not get tricky.